<br />18. Amendments. This Joint Powers Agreement may be amended at any time <br />with the agreement of the majority of the members representing a majority of the population of <br />the County, except as provided in 3(d). <br />19. Clean Air Vehicle Re~istration Fee Pro2ram. C/CAG shall serve as the <br />overall program manager for the San Mateo County under Health and Safety Code Section 44241 <br />for funds made available by the increase in motor vehicle registration fees that the Bay Area Air <br />Quality Management District is authorized to levy under A.B. 434, (1991 Statutes, Chapter 807.) <br />21.
